Exploring this World of Digestive Enzymes: Types, Functions, and Applications
The human body is a complex machine that relies on numerous operations to function efficiently. Among these, digestion holds a crucial role in breaking down food into usable nutrients. Digestive enzymes are proteins that accelerate these transformations. They Enzymes for Digestive Comfort and Health work by facilitating the decomposition of food components into simpler units that can be utilized by the body.
- Various types of digestive enzymes exist in different parts of the alimentary canal, each with a specific function.
- Situations include amylase, which degrades carbohydrates; protease, which cleaves proteins; and lipase, which acts on fats.
